## Runbook: Flaky DNS in Mossvale Cluster

Symptom: intermittent NXDOMAIN on internal lookups, roughly 2% of queries. First step: query the Ledgefield resolver telemetry API and compare failure timestamps against the cache-flush schedule. If correlated, restart the stub resolvers; if not, escalate to the Nethaven platform team. Telemetry access requires the read-only diagnostics key, rotated weekly. Current key for the telemetry endpoint follows.

service key, yadug-bajog: zpat3_pou

### Ticket: Config drift on ChronoPace chip readers

Hey plugin folks — we're seeing drift between the reader fleet at the Harwick Bay Marathon and what's in our Pacekeeper repo. Some readers got hand-tweaked antenna gain and dedup windows during race day and nobody synced the changes back. If your plugin reads these values at startup, it may behave differently per unit. We're re-baselining this week, so please test against the canonical settings. For reference, the baseline configuration we're rolling out is below.

config for kagup-hahig:
druwyn:
  pin: 2801
  metrics_host: metrics.druwyn.zemvarlabs.internal
  tenant: sorius
  seal: seal_798a43d7

Subject: Handover — Crumbfort cutoff release

Taking over from me this cycle: the order-cutoff rule for Crumbfort Bakery ships Thursday. Cutoff is 14:00 store-local; the config flag is `cutoff_strict`, already staged. Don't merge anything touching the order queue after Wednesday noon. Rollback is one revert, tested. To push the release tag you'll need the deploy key below.

deploy key for kajof-fajop: bky6_gDHw9Q

## Pricefeed Gateway — Environments

Welcome aboard! Pricefeed Gateway calls the upstream Quotabin API, which flakes out more than we'd like, so we wrap every call in a circuit breaker. Staging trips faster than prod on purpose — don't panic when it opens during load tests. The breaker thresholds and timeouts differ per environment. Here are the current staging values.

settings of fafog-haduf:
ZORIX_PIN=4648
ZORIX_METRICS_HOST=metrics.zorix.paliqsys.corp
ZORIX_LOG_LEVEL=info
ZORIX_TENANT=druix